Understanding Bespoke Window Fitting
Bespoke window fitting describes personalized windows designed specifically to suit a house owner’s unique requirements. Unlike off-the-shelf windows, bespoke alternatives can be crafted in numerous styles, products, and completes to line up with individual tastes and architectural themes. Whether for a new develop or a renovation project, bespoke window fitters work closely with customers to ensure the end product delivers both aesthetic satisfaction and performance.

With a variety of alternatives offered, bespoke window fitters can create windows that complement your home’s design. Here are a few popular types:

Casement Windows
Hinged at the side, these windows open outside to supply outstanding ventilation.
Sash Window Experts Windows
A traditional option, these windows have sliding sashes that can add a touch of beauty to any property.
Tilt and Turn Windows
These flexible windows can either open inwards or tilt, making them easy to clean and practical for smaller areas.
Bay and Bow Windows
These extend beyond the exterior wall, developing additional area and improving the outside view.
Skylights
Ideal for lofts or spaces with limited wall space, skylights enable natural light to flood in from above.

For how long does it take to install bespoke windows?
The installation timeframe depends upon different factors, including the number of windows, the complexity of the design, and the fitters’ schedule. Generally, bespoke window installation can take anywhere from a few days to a few weeks.
2. Are bespoke windows more pricey than basic options?
Bespoke windows tend to be more expensive than standard off-the-shelf choices due to the custom craftsmanship and materials included. However, the financial investment can be beneficial given the distinct functions and possible energy cost savings.
3. What products are best for bespoke windows?
The very best product depends on private preferences and requirements. Timber uses classic beauty and insulation, while aluminum provides a modern appearance with resilience. uPVC is an economical choice understood for its low maintenance and energy performance.
4. Can bespoke windows improve home security?
Yes, bespoke windows can improve security by utilizing enhanced glass and robust locking mechanisms customized to the particular window design.
5. How do I preserve bespoke windows?
Maintenance requirements depend upon the product. Wood might require periodic staining or painting, while aluminum and uPVC require periodic cleaning. It’s suggested to seek advice from the fitters for particular maintenance guidelines per product.
